Local Comedian Mpho “Popps” Modikoane has landed a new gig on Mzansi Magic’s new show Spirit of Mzansi.

The show will see eight South Africans battle it out in the new Volkswagen Amarok Extreme, for a chance at bagging the massive R 250 000 grand prize.

The show is brought by Mzansi magic in partnership with Volkswagen Commercial Vehicles and will feature two teams of unlikely companions who will battle it out in races that will put their driving skills to the ultimate test.

In the powerful 3.0 V6 Amarok Extreme, teams will be racing to the Moses Mabhida Stadium in Durban and every evening these teams will be forced to vote out one of their team members until only one is left and crowned the winner.

Modikoane has previously hosted a similar show on etv when he was the co-host of reality competition series So You Think You Can Spin, in which contestants competed to win the title of the country's best spinner.

Spirit of Mzansi will premier on the 18th of August on Mzansi Magic.
